The Berserkers - cold, steel, killing machines.  Their one purpose - to wipe out all of humanity.  Sounds cheerful doesn’t it?  Fred Saberhagen has created the ultimate nightmare of technology gone mad in Berserkers:  The Beginning.

Think of Berserkers as a kind of sentient death star, able to replicate and repair themselves.  This first book in the series is a collection of loosely connected short stories.  I really enjoyed the way that Saberhagen played with this concept.  Some of the stories are grim, as you might expect, and others are light, humorous pieces.

I highly recommend this book, but have this question for all of you Saberhagen fans in blogland. My impression is that later novels in the series turned into straight-up military science fiction, how do they compare to this one?  Are they worth the read?
